ザ・グラフ(GRT)を活用した成功事例トップ!
はじめに
ザ・グラフ(GRT)は、ブロックチェーン技術を活用したデータインデックスプロトコルであり、Web3アプリケーション開発において不可欠な存在となっています。従来の集中型データベースとは異なり、分散型かつ透明性の高いデータアクセスを提供することで、新たなビジネスモデルやアプリケーションの創出を可能にします。本稿では、ザ・グラフを活用した成功事例を詳細に分析し、その技術的優位性とビジネス上のメリットを明らかにします。事例は、DeFi(分散型金融)、NFT(非代替性トークン)、ゲーム、ソーシャルメディアなど、多岐にわたる分野から選定し、それぞれの導入背景、技術的な実装、そして得られた成果について深く掘り下げていきます。
ザ・グラフ(GRT)の基礎知識
ザ・グラフは、イーサリアムをはじめとするブロックチェーン上のデータを効率的にクエリするためのインデックス作成プロトコルです。ブロックチェーン上のデータは、トランザクション履歴やスマートコントラクトの状態など、膨大な量であり、直接アクセスするには非常に時間がかかります。ザ・グラフは、これらのデータをインデックス化し、GraphQLというクエリ言語を用いて高速かつ柔軟にアクセスできるようにします。これにより、アプリケーション開発者は、ブロックチェーン上のデータを容易に利用し、複雑なデータ処理を効率的に行うことができます。
ザ・グラフの主な特徴は以下の通りです。
- 分散型:中央集権的なサーバーに依存せず、グローバルなネットワーク上で動作します。
- 透明性:インデックス作成のプロセスは公開されており、データの信頼性を確保します。
- 効率性:GraphQLを用いることで、必要なデータのみを効率的に取得できます。
- 柔軟性:様々なブロックチェーンに対応し、多様なデータ構造をサポートします。
成功事例1:Aave – DeFiにおけるデータ可視化
Aaveは、分散型貸付プラットフォームであり、ザ・グラフを活用することで、プラットフォーム上の貸付・借入状況をリアルタイムで可視化しています。従来のシステムでは、ブロックチェーン上のデータを直接解析する必要があり、データの取得に時間がかかり、ユーザーエクスペリエンスが低下していました。ザ・グラフを導入することで、Aaveは、貸付金利、利用可能な資産、ユーザーのポジションなど、重要なデータを高速かつ効率的に取得し、ダッシュボードやAPIを通じてユーザーに提供できるようになりました。これにより、ユーザーは、より迅速かつ正確な情報に基づいて取引判断を行うことができ、プラットフォームの利用率向上に貢献しています。
技術的な実装としては、Aaveのスマートコントラクトから発生するイベントをザ・グラフのサブグラフで監視し、必要なデータを抽出してインデックス化しています。GraphQL APIを通じて、これらのデータにアクセスできるようになり、フロントエンドアプリケーションで容易に利用できるようになりました。
成功事例2:OpenSea – NFTマーケットプレイスにおけるメタデータ管理
OpenSeaは、世界最大級のNFTマーケットプレイスであり、ザ・グラフを活用することで、NFTのメタデータ管理を効率化しています。NFTのメタデータは、NFTの名称、説明、属性など、NFTを識別するための重要な情報であり、マーケットプレイスの検索機能や表示機能に不可欠です。従来のシステムでは、メタデータを手動で管理する必要があり、データの整合性や更新性に課題がありました。ザ・グラフを導入することで、OpenSeaは、NFTのメタデータを自動的にインデックス化し、GraphQL APIを通じて高速かつ柔軟にアクセスできるようになりました。これにより、ユーザーは、NFTを容易に検索・発見し、取引をスムーズに行うことができるようになりました。
技術的な実装としては、NFTのスマートコントラクトから発生するイベントをザ・グラフのサブグラフで監視し、NFTのメタデータを抽出してインデックス化しています。GraphQL APIを通じて、これらのデータにアクセスできるようになり、フロントエンドアプリケーションで容易に利用できるようになりました。
成功事例3:Decentraland – メタバースにおける土地所有権管理
Decentralandは、ブロックチェーン上に構築されたメタバースであり、ザ・グラフを活用することで、土地の所有権管理を効率化しています。Decentralandの土地は、NFTとして表現されており、土地の所有権はブロックチェーン上で記録されます。従来のシステムでは、土地の所有権情報をブロックチェーンから直接取得する必要があり、データの取得に時間がかかり、メタバースのパフォーマンスに影響を与えていました。ザ・グラフを導入することで、Decentralandは、土地の所有権情報を自動的にインデックス化し、GraphQL APIを通じて高速かつ柔軟にアクセスできるようになりました。これにより、ユーザーは、土地の所有権情報を容易に確認し、メタバース内での活動をスムーズに行うことができるようになりました。
技術的な実装としては、土地のNFTスマートコントラクトから発生するイベントをザ・グラフのサブグラフで監視し、土地の所有権情報を抽出してインデックス化しています。GraphQL APIを通じて、これらのデータにアクセスできるようになり、メタバースのクライアントアプリケーションで容易に利用できるようになりました。
成功事例4:Lens Protocol – 分散型ソーシャルメディアにおけるコンテンツインデックス
Lens Protocolは、ブロックチェーン上に構築された分散型ソーシャルメディアであり、ザ・グラフを活用することで、コンテンツのインデックス作成を効率化しています。従来のソーシャルメディアでは、コンテンツは中央集権的なサーバーに保存され、管理されます。Lens Protocolでは、コンテンツはブロックチェーン上に保存され、ユーザーが所有権を持ちます。ザ・グラフを導入することで、Lens Protocolは、コンテンツを自動的にインデックス化し、GraphQL APIを通じて高速かつ柔軟にアクセスできるようになりました。これにより、ユーザーは、コンテンツを容易に検索・発見し、ソーシャルメディアの利用をより楽しむことができるようになりました。
技術的な実装としては、Lens Protocolのスマートコントラクトから発生するイベントをザ・グラフのサブグラフで監視し、コンテンツの情報を抽出してインデックス化しています。GraphQL APIを通じて、これらのデータにアクセスできるようになり、フロントエンドアプリケーションで容易に利用できるようになりました。
ザ・グラフ(GRT)導入における課題と対策
ザ・グラフの導入には、いくつかの課題も存在します。例えば、サブグラフの開発・運用には専門的な知識が必要であり、データの整合性を維持するための監視体制も構築する必要があります。また、ブロックチェーンのトランザクション量が増加すると、インデックス作成の処理負荷が増加し、パフォーマンスが低下する可能性があります。これらの課題に対しては、以下の対策を講じることが有効です。
- 専門知識の習得:ザ・グラフのドキュメントやチュートリアルを活用し、サブグラフの開発・運用に関する知識を習得する。
- 監視体制の構築:サブグラフのパフォーマンスやデータの整合性を監視するためのツールを導入し、異常を早期に検知する。
- 最適化:サブグラフのコードを最適化し、インデックス作成の処理負荷を軽減する。
- スケーリング:ザ・グラフのネットワークに参加し、インデックス作成の処理能力を向上させる。
今後の展望
ザ・グラフは、Web3アプリケーション開発において、ますます重要な役割を果たすことが予想されます。ブロックチェーン技術の普及に伴い、ブロックチェーン上のデータ量は増加の一途をたどっており、ザ・グラフのようなデータインデックスプロトコルの需要は高まるでしょう。今後は、より多くのブロックチェーンに対応し、より高度なデータ処理機能を提供することで、Web3アプリケーションの可能性をさらに広げることが期待されます。また、ザ・グラフのネットワークに参加するインデクサーの増加や、サブグラフの開発ツールの改善なども、今後の発展を促進する要因となるでしょう。
まとめ
本稿では、ザ・グラフ(GRT)を活用した成功事例を詳細に分析し、その技術的優位性とビジネス上のメリットを明らかにしました。Aave、OpenSea、Decentraland、Lens Protocolなどの事例は、ザ・グラフがDeFi、NFT、メタバース、ソーシャルメディアなど、多岐にわたる分野で活用され、新たな価値を創造していることを示しています。ザ・グラフの導入には課題も存在しますが、適切な対策を講じることで、これらの課題を克服し、Web3アプリケーションの可能性を最大限に引き出すことができます。今後、ザ・グラフは、Web3エコシステムの発展に不可欠なインフラとして、ますます重要な役割を担っていくでしょう。